November 3 - This month promises to be action packed and particularly
lucrative at
Party Poker, as players are offered the chance to win
points, cash and even a seat to the 2010 Aussie Millions.
Party Poker, the industry leading
online poker room run by the Gibraltar based Party
Gaming group, brings the Gladiator to its poker room from November 1st to 30th,
2009 and this year's promotion promises to be bigger and better than ever
before.
During this month, players are rewarded for regular poker play at all types
of offerings at Party Poker, ranging from sit and go's to cash tables and multi
table tournaments.
If players manage to hit a daily minimum target of earning 10 Party Points
for five days during November, they are rewarded the minimum reward - entry into
a very generous freeroll with a top prize of $5,000!
The more points that players earn and the more days they manage to accumulate
these points, the more chances they have of winning big at Party Poker.
Players who manage to earn 1000 points by playing for 25 days during November
stand the chance to win cash prizes worth up to $3000!
But for those who are going for the big prize - a guaranteed Main Event seat
into the 2010 Aussie Millions - their poker activity at Party Poker during
November will need to be fast and furious!
The Aussie Millions prize package can be won by those players who earn 1000
points on every day in the month of November and is worth a staggering $10,500.
